1. In combination with a vehicle body having a door opening for ingress/egress to a passenger compartment, the door opening being framed at its upper edge by a roof rail extending longitudinally of the compartment and at its forward edge by a windshield side pillar extending downwardly from the forward end of the roof rail to a vertical hinge pillar to which the door is hinged for swinging movement between opened and closed positions and a floor mounted passenger seat adjacent the door opening,a passive belt system for restraining a seat occupant within the seat, comprising:

  • a two-point belt anchored at one end to a vehicle floor fixed attachment means at the inboard side of the seat and at its other end to a retractor mechanism anchored in the vehicle roof rearwardly and outwardly of the seat,the belt in passenger restraining position extending diagonally over the upper torso of a seat occupant from the floor attachment to the retractor mechanism,track means paralleling the roof rail and extending from the forward end of the latter downwardly along the windshield pillar,carriage means movable along the track means having belt engageable means engageable with the belt intermediate the anchored ends of the latter,and nonelectrical energizing means responsive to the motion of the door when moved to door opening position to energize the belt system,the energizing means including a lever means swingable in the door opening about a door hinge pivot,a compressed fluid linear actuator mounted on the vehicle body forwardly of the hinge pillar and coupled to the lever means to swing the same outwardly of the door opening,and a displacement multiplying multiple-sheave block mounted on the vehicle body forwardly of the hinge pillar operatively interposed between the lever means and the carriage means whereby short linear movement of the piston rod of the actuator swinging the lever means provides multiplied linear movement of the carriage means along the track means,the carriage means being movable by the energizing means along the track means from the retractor end of the latter to the point at which the track means swings downwardly along the windshield pillar, the carriage means movement terminating at a terminal position near the hinge pillar end of the track means,the carriage means during such movement automatically withdrawing the belt forwardly from its passenger restraining position toward the forward end of the compartment to provide unobstructed ingress or egress to the compartment through the door opening.
